Rapper Kanye West announced Saturday – two weeks after announcing he was making a late bid for the presidency – that he would be holding his first campaign event in South Carolina.
The event will take place at the Exquis Even Center in North Charleston on Sunday at 5 p.m., giving potential attendees little time to plan, ABC News reported. The event is limited to “registered guests only,” and West provided a link to his campaign website – Kanye2020.country – where they can sign up, however, at the time he posted the link, there was no dedicated link to sign up for the event, ABC reported.
